A Computer Server is Essential For Growing Businesses

By Ian Parfett


For growing companies with several computers already in use, a computer server is a valuable investment. Many small business owners find that without the many benefits that a server offers, their business functions at a less efficient and productive rate.

As a company develops, the amount of data it must store increases and a small group of networked computers become insufficient. At that time a server is essential to store and organise all of your business data and resources in one place and allow appropriate access by all members of staff as required.

Storing all company information in one central place with a single server has many great benefits. A server will process, manage and store each and every bit of information that passes through every computer within its network. Generally, servers have very powerful processors and vast memory capacity.

A server allows software programmes and data to be shared easily between various staff and manages the sharing of essential resources within a network of computers. An illustration of this would be various staff members all sharing access to a central office printer.

Additionally you may gain remote access through a server to the company email and files. Information is secure and safely protected from unauthorised usage Extra security is in place through back up files which are essential for disaster recovery.

It can be really difficult to select the right technology to address the requirements of your company, because there are numerous different types of servers and software available to choose from.

You must consider the fact that a growing business will be accumulating a growing amount of data to manage and store. Therefore, your server has to be able to handle the future demands that will be required of it.

The size of your company will dictate the size of server that will be necessary. There are very small servers that have only slightly more power than a desktop pc. A small scale company may be able to get by sufficiently with a server of this size. At the opposite end of the scale, big companies require a large server with plenty of hard disk space, RAM, and processors.

Windows servers are a popular choice because of their great security and excellent built in features. Because so many people already run a Windows operating system they often offer easy integration. However, there are a range of alternatives available.
